Road closure to last about three weeks
CLINTON—A portion of Hobbton Highway (U.S. 701 Business) north of Issac Weeks Road in Clinton will be closed to traffic beginning, Tuesday, May 1. The closure is needed so N.C. Department of Transportation crews can replace a damaged drainage pipe that runs under the road.
The road closure will start at 9 a.m. and continue through Friday, May 25. Traffic will be detoured to Dixon Street and North Boulevard and continue to Hobbton Highway.
Transportation officials urge travelers to use caution on the detour routes during the closure.
